Role: Manufacturing Engineer
Location: Cheltenham
Duration: 12 months
Inside IR35: Umbrella
About Our Client:
Our client is a leading aerospace engineering company specializing in jet engines, avionics, and integrated systems for both military and commercial aircraft. They operate major UK facilities, including maintenance, repair, and overhaul (MRO) sites.
We are seeking a skilled Manufacturing Engineer.
